Loadboxes

A loadbox is an IR loader that is meant to be plugged at the power output of a Tube amplifier head. It usually includes an inductive load to simulate the presence of a loudspeaker.

Therefore the input impedance is usually 4 ohms / 8ohms / 16 ohms as would be an electric guitar cabinet.

It is also heavier built as it must be able to dissipate 100W or more into heat.

This is not appropriate for acoustic guitars!!
